The Children's Wainwright Prize for Fiction

Shortlist 2025

Ettie and the Midnight Pool

By Julia Green and Pam Smy

Ettie has lived with just her grandma and the wild woods as her playground.

Until she meets Cora, and she starts to crave more – now she wants to explore further.

When Cora leads her to the hidden quarry pool, Ettie is ready to jump straight in.

But the quarry has secrets too, and Ettie will have to dive deep into the darkness to uncover them . . .

About Julia Green and Pam Smy

Julia Green is an author of over twenty novels and stories for children and young adults. She has worked as a publicity assistant for a publisher, a library assistant, an English teacher, and is currently Emeritus Professor of Writing for Young People at Bath Spa University.

Pam Smy has illustrated folktales, chapter books, nursery rhyme collections, picture books and novels. She has had 20 years of art school teaching and lecturing experience at Cambridge School of Art and, over this time, has developed an understanding of how to nurture creative process and work through ideas with illustrators. She has a passion for observational drawing and sketchbooks.
